Advice please, I have just reconditioned a quad 303 and within that replaced transistors 38495/6 on the driver boards and 38495 on power supply board. Anyone who knows these amps will be aware that the previous transistors had an oversized flange which quad utilised to place a large metal heatsink over the transistor, however, the replacements (BC441 and BC461) do not have this. You can still attach the quad heatsink, however, the thermal contact area is far reduced. Some Quad enthusiasts I have contacted have said that this is ok as the components are not being pushed that hard and thus don't generate significant heat. Space on the boards is minimal and even the smallest of TO-5/39 heatsink is a bit of a squash. Has anybody else encountered this?
